Barcelona’s Bold Move: Rashford Registration Hinges on Star Player’s Exit

Barcelona’s ambitious summer plans face a significant hurdle as the club grapples with the intricate challenge of officially registering star loan signing Marcus Rashford for the upcoming 2025/26 season. Despite securing the talented English forward, the Catalan giants find themselves in a precarious position, reportedly needing to offload a current player to comply with stringent La Liga financial regulations.

Rashford, who arrived at Spotify Camp Nou on loan from Manchester United, represents a pivotal acquisition for Hansi Flick’s squad. His move to Spain was intended to reinvigorate a career that had somewhat stalled in England, offering him a fresh start and a prominent role within Barcelona’s attacking framework. This high-profile Football Transfer is central to the club’s strategy to maintain its competitive edge and challenge for top honors.

The agreement between Barcelona and Manchester United includes an option for a permanent transfer, reportedly valued at £26 million, contingent upon Rashford’s performance and the club’s financial maneuverability. However, the immediate priority revolves around ensuring his formal registration, a process complicated by existing squad dynamics and salary cap considerations under La Liga Regulations.

As part of their strategic reshuffling, Barcelona’s focus has turned towards one of their promising academy graduates, Marc Casado. Reports indicate that the club is considering the sale of the 21-year-old La Masia alumnus as a potential solution to free up the necessary funds and squad space required for Marcus Rashford Registration.

Adding a layer of complexity to this internal transfer saga is Casado’s apparent reluctance to depart from his boyhood club. Having made his senior debut in November 2022 and with two international caps to his name, Casado views his Marc Casado Future firmly within the Barcelona setup, eager to continue his development under coach Flick.

Despite the player’s desire to stay, FC Barcelona Transfer News suggests the club is actively exploring options for Casado, including a permanent transfer or a paid loan deal with an option to buy. This demonstrates the club’s pragmatic approach to navigating its financial constraints while attempting to optimize its Barcelona Squad Updates for the forthcoming campaign.

The situation highlights the persistent balancing act faced by top European clubs in the modern transfer market, where sporting ambitions must align with strict financial fair play rules. Barcelona’s pursuit of elite talent like Rashford often necessitates difficult decisions regarding their existing roster, making this a crucial period for the club’s strategic planning.
